A) Can BD Rebuilder take advantage of multicores and if so how many?
|
Yes it can, but it is a hidden setting. Look in the "hiddenopts.txt" file (in the same folder as BDRB.exe) for information.

B) I'm using BD-25 medium. In order to achieve the highest possible quality in both video and audio what setting would I use, if time was no object? I have tried "keepHD audio for BD-25"
|
Keeping HD audio is probably not a good idea. It takes a lot of space and yields negligible (or, really, "no") audible benefit. The space used for the HD audio would be much better used for higher quality video encoding.

"Highest" checked in the encoder setting, was this the propper way? If so, the only question remaining would be should I leave the CBR and ABR unchecked?
|
Highest is probably overkill. With BD25, "good" is probably good enough, but if you don't mind waiting a long time for the encode to finish then "highest" will be, technically, the best quality. And, yes, for best quality uncheck both CBR and ABR to get 2-pass encoding.
